Output 593473406b5139a1d4dd533c74ad9d2f99d67523a647df4aae8aeddc01ba2d2a:1

value
8683
script pubkey
OP_0 OP_PUSHBYTES_20 700256c7e075b6b882440ef6ebdb00aa4558e11a
address
bc1qwqp9d3lqwkmt3qjypmmwhkcq4fz43cg6uas5u6
transaction
593473406b5139a1d4dd533c74ad9d2f99d67523a647df4aae8aeddc01ba2d2a
spent
true